Job Description :
This position will be part of the Waste Management Network. The team, which is responsible for management and coordination of waste related activities, consists of approximately 5 team members ranging in experience from one to twenty years. This position will report to the Waste Management Network Manager. This position will provide support for waste management activities for multiple environmental projects through all phases of the typical life cycle of a site. Some sites will require a waste classification of the waste stream, while others may require updates to existing profiles. As new areas of sites are remediated, work plans for managing the potential waste stream will need to be developed. As a waste management specialist the individual will be required to work with the client's procurement group to set up new work orders or purchase orders with approved vendors for treatment and disposal of various wastes. After completion of the project, the individual will manage project disposal records and assist with required reporting to over site agencies.
Tasks will include activities focused on waste management for Superfund, RCRA Corrective Action, RCRA Closure, and UST sites
. Waste classification
. Profile approval and waste acceptance
. Support procurement of vendor services
. Vendor coordination with project team
. Work plan development
. Reporting
This position reports to the waste management network manager, but will work under the supervision of the appropriate project manager. Position will interact with both clients (routinely) and Regulatory agencies such as the EPA (occasionally). Will also interact with multi-discipline and multi-office teams within URS. Must be able to work effectively in team situations and establish strong relationships with other teams where overlap of client project work exists. The individual must be familiar with federal and state waste management programs; experience with hazardous, universal, TSCA, and solid wastes; knowledge of DOT shipping regulations; and knowledge of beneficial re-use and recycling.
